Muay Thai Fight Analysis: Superlek vs Naito

Aug 15, 2024

Muay Thai Fight Overview

Fight Structure

  • Three rounds of Muay Thai.
  • No striking allowed to the back of the head or groin.
  • Emphasis on strength, fairness, and strict adherence to instructions.

Opening Round Highlights

  • Competitors: Superlek Ketmulka vs. Taiki Naito.
  • Superlek's Strategy:
    • Uses a variety of attacks, primarily off his right side.
    • Focuses on body kicks (49% usage).
    • Attempts high kicks and elbows early on.
    • Effective at breaking down opponents by targeting the body and legs.
  • Naito's Defense:
    • Demonstrates good evasion and countering skills.
    • Remains relaxed, not fazed by Superlek’s strikes.
    • Needs to put together combinations to relieve pressure.
    • Focuses on countering Superlek's kicks but needs more aggression.

Fight Dynamics

  • Superlek mixes weapons: tips to the body, legs, and head kicks.
  • Naito counters with leg kicks to disrupt Superlek’s balance.
  • Observations on Superlek's striking:
    • Strong emphasis on leg kicks and body strikes.
    • Displays a mix of high and low strikes early in the round.

Round Two Highlights

  • Superlek shows increased aggression following an illegal strike.
  • Focuses on body kicks and leg kicks, causing noticeable damage to Naito.
  • Naito continues to rely on defense but counters effectively at times.
  • Superlek displays a powerful and aggressive approach, especially with elbows.
    • He attempts to finish the fight with elbows, increasing pressure.
  • Naito has to avoid being trapped against the wall to prevent Superlek from capitalizing.

Key Moments

  • Superlek finds success in close range with elbows, significantly impacting Naito.
  • The fight sees Superlek transitioning from kicking range to elbow range effectively.
  • Naito's need for aggression becomes critical as he falls behind.

Final Round Observations

  • Superlek maintains dominant pressure, showcasing mastery in close combat.
  • Naito struggles to establish a counter-strategy and remains primarily defensive.
  • Superlek's ability to throw powerful kicks from close proximity is highlighted.
  • Naito must be more aggressive to change the fight dynamics.

Conclusion

  • The fight ends with Superlek Kiyotmuka winning by unanimous decision.
  • He advances to the semi-finals as the tournament favorite, demonstrating skills and strong fight IQ.
